Multifamily Acquisitions in Donelson / Airport

The Donelson / Airport corridor sits directly around Nashville International Airport (BNA). BNA's ongoing multi-billion-dollar expansion, the Amazon Nashville operations base, the growing airport-district hotel and services cluster, and Donelson's traditional working-household renter base combine to produce a genuine basis-and-yield submarket inside Davidson County.

Market Brief

KADAK's View of the Donelson / Airport Multifamily Market

Demand Drivers

BNA is one of the fastest-growing large-hub airports in the U.S., and the multi-billion-dollar terminal expansion has anchored a durable airport-district employment cluster. Amazon's Nashville operations base sits directly in the corridor. Donelson's traditional working-household renter base gives the submarket a genuine yield floor that many Davidson County submarkets don't have. The corridor has been more supply-disciplined than the urban core. B+ effective rent has been stable. Basis is defensible on 2015–2022 vintage priced against current rents.
